Output 7bd34875ea13c5bf1891fd6ea37d6e370e10ebd49b718c49d141a3ab2ea02482:0

value
16803648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 303c596fbe723aef27db79dda774867300e2ac50 OP_EQUAL
address
3664eu5eXCWjerU8zfRTkyMEirodTji9YJ
transaction
7bd34875ea13c5bf1891fd6ea37d6e370e10ebd49b718c49d141a3ab2ea02482
confirmations
340355
spent
true